WebA tear in the retina, also known as a retinal break, is a tiny hole that develops in the periphery of the retina. A retinal tear or hole may cause a retinal detachment if the fluid that is contained inside the hollow of the eye moves through the hole and detaches the retina at the same time. WebMay 9, 2024 · The macula is a small area in the center of the retina (the light-sensitive layer of tissue in the back of the eye). Macular holes happen when an opening forms in the macula — usually after being stretched or pulled. Most macular holes form because of changes in the eye that happen as you age.

WebJan 6, 2024 · Your surgeon uses a laser to heat small pinpoints on the retina. This creates scarring that usually binds (welds) the retina to the underlying tissue. Immediate laser treatment of a new retinal tear can decrease the chance of it causing a retinal detachment.
